Explore America: Oklahoma

Explore America and discover people, places, art, and history that connect to Oklahoma in the Smithsonian’s collections. Held in trust for the American people, the Smithsonian’s collections document the country’s history, art from across the globe, scientific discovery, and the vast wonders of the natural and cultural world.
